What I Look for in the Best Rib Protectors
When I shop for rib protectors, I pay attention to a few things:
- Protection level: I want enough padding to absorb impact without being too bulky.
- Fit: A good rib protector should sit snugly and stay in place during movement.
- Comfort: If it feels stiff or irritating, I know I won’t want to wear it all game.
- Mobility: As a quarterback, I need to throw, twist, and move freely.
- Durability: I prefer gear that can handle repeated contact and still hold up.
- Compatibility: I make sure it works well with my shoulder pads and jersey.
The Types of Rib Protectors I Usually Consider
I’ve found that rib protectors generally come in a few styles:
- Attached rib protectors: These connect directly to shoulder pads and feel integrated.
- Wraparound styles: I like these when I want extra coverage around the ribs and lower back.
- Lightweight models: These are best when I want protection without much extra weight.
- Heavy-duty models: I choose these when I know I’ll be facing more aggressive contact.
How I Decide on the Right Fit
Fit is one of the biggest things I check. If a rib protector is too loose, it shifts around and loses effectiveness. If it’s too tight, it can limit my breathing and movement. I always try to find a balance where it feels secure but still natural. I also make sure it lines up properly with my shoulder pads so I’m not adjusting it during the game.
Comfort and Mobility Matter to Me
As a quarterback, I can’t afford to feel slowed down. I need to drop back, rotate my torso, and deliver passes quickly. That’s why I prefer rib protectors with flexible padding and a design that doesn’t dig into my sides. I’ve learned that the most protective option isn’t always the best if it sacrifices mobility.
Materials I Prefer
I usually look for rib protectors made with:
- High-density foam: For solid impact absorption.
- Lightweight plastic shells: For added protection in key areas.
- Breathable fabrics: To help reduce heat and sweat buildup.
- Moisture-wicking liners: To keep me more comfortable during long practices and games.
